Output 22b660050bdc22321821648c24b1cd80f1aa9adb65ff2ca52c20503cdc8791c9:1

value
2640154047
script pubkey
OP_0 OP_PUSHBYTES_20 bf3d7648b826605287baf57da6f0d49ab000ffdf
address
tb1qhu7hvj9cyes99pa67476dux5n2cqpl7lpjc373
transaction
22b660050bdc22321821648c24b1cd80f1aa9adb65ff2ca52c20503cdc8791c9
confirmations
109035
spent
true